Ford revs in quality survey Ford Motor Co.'s three domestic brands all received above-average marks in J.D. Power and Associates' influential annual survey of vehicle dependability, but several General Motors Corp. brands slipped in the rankings and all Chrysler LLC brands remained well below the industry average, led by a steep decline for Jeep. Toyota Motor Corp. continued to dominate the top of the chart, with its luxury Lexus brand holding on to first place with 120 problems reported per 100 vehicles. Ford's Mercury brand --... Ford shelving F-100 development in favor of EcoBoost Executives at Ford are so enthusiastic about the possibilities for fuel efficiency in their EcoBoost forced-induction engines that they have decided to shelve plans for a smaller ‘F-100′ pickup truck. Likewise, importation of the Ranger from South Africa to the U.S. has also been canned in favor of the new technology. Also at the focus of the efficient powertrain buildup is a range of new transmissions. The combination of more efficient, smaller displacement turbocharged engines and more... Ford Escape plug-in prototype shows potential Automakers are moving fast to determine whether plug-in hybrid electric vehicles can be put onto the market affordably.PHEVs can up to triple fuel mileage in short trips, and recharging costs less than gas to go the same distance. It appears that plug-ins cut tailpipe emissions more than enough to make up for any pollution caused by the plants that generate the electricity to charge them.A special thanks to AutoSpies.com friend friend Fred Khaz for these pictures.[source] Article added: 2008-07-21 08:44:45 Article Views Rating: 314

2009 Ford F-150 Ford has produced more than 33 million F-Series pickups since its launch in 1948, and for 2009, the truck has been totally revamped both externally and under the skin. The tough, new exterior is dominated by a dramatic three-bar grille, and the F-150’s cabin is more spacious, flexible and refined. A new high-strength, lighter-weight chassis allows the truck to deliver more horsepower, improved fuel economy, higher safety and additional towing and payload capacity. The new model offers... New Ford Focus RS It's been rumored, spied and denied, but the Blue Oval boys have finally made it official: the Focus RS is on its way. The successor to the Escort RS Cosworth and the last generation Focus RS will be based off the current Focus ST and come equipped with a turbocharged 2.5-liter inline-five producing around 280 HP and 295 lb.-ft. of torque. The suspension and chassis will be tuned to compete with the new Evo X and Subaru Impreza STI, and will include plenty of rally-inspired kit, blistered wheel arches...
